EASEZW2 ;ALB/AMA - Auto-process 1010EZ from Web-based Application, part 2 ; 7/31/08 2:17pm
Source file <EASEZW2.m>
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
Enrollment Application System | 1 | EASEZW |
Name | Comments | DBIA/ICR reference |
---|---|---|
SEC3 | ;special parsing for Section III
|
|
NMSSNDOB | ;find applicant's name,ssn,dob in data subrecords & file in main record
|
|
VETTYPE(EASAPP) | ;derive a veteran type categorization for this Applicant
|
|
DESIGNEE | ;set either NOK or E-CONTACT data into DESIGNEE
|
|
DSGDAT | ;
|
|
CONFIRM(EASWEBID,EASAPP,EASXMZ) | ;confirm receipt of web submission message to Forum
|
Name | Field # of Occurrence |
---|---|
FILE^DICN | DESIGNEE+23 |
^DIE | SEC3+28, NMSSNDOB+21, DESIGNEE+27 |
WP^DIE | SEC3+30 |
EN^DIQ1 | CONFIRM+7 |
$$SSNOUT^EASEZT1 | NMSSNDOB+13 |
$$UC^EASEZT1 | NMSSNDOB+10 |
$$DATA712^EASEZU1 | NMSSNDOB+3, NMSSNDOB+4, NMSSNDOB+5, NMSSNDOB+6, NMSSNDOB+13, NMSSNDOB+15, VETTYPE+6, VETTYPE+7, VETTYPE+8, VETTYPE+9 , VETTYPE+10, DESIGNEE+3, DESIGNEE+15 |
$$KEY711^EASEZU1 | NMSSNDOB+3, NMSSNDOB+4, NMSSNDOB+5, NMSSNDOB+6, NMSSNDOB+12, NMSSNDOB+14, VETTYPE+6, VETTYPE+7, VETTYPE+8, VETTYPE+9 , VETTYPE+10, DESIGNEE+2, DESIGNEE+9, DESIGNEE+19 |
^XMD | CONFIRM+16 |
FileNo | Call Tags |
---|---|
^EAS(712 - [#712] | Classic Fileman Calls, WP^DIE |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^DD(712 | DESIGNEE+22 |
^EAS(711 - [#711] | NMSSNDOB+17 |
^EAS(712 - [#712] | DESIGNEE+20 |
^TMP("1010EZRC" | CONFIRM+9*, CONFIRM+10*, CONFIRM+12*, CONFIRM+17! |
^XMB("NETNAME" | CONFIRM+8 |
Name | Line Occurrences |
---|---|
$$VETTYPE | NMSSNDOB+16 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
ARRAY | CONFIRM+4~ |
ARRAY(712 | CONFIRM+8, CONFIRM+12 |
C | SEC3+1~, SEC3+8* |
DA | SEC3+1~, SEC3+24*, SEC3+29!, NMSSNDOB+2~, NMSSNDOB+18!*, DESIGNEE+1~, DESIGNEE+25*, CONFIRM+4~, CONFIRM+6* |
DA(1 | DESIGNEE+22*, DESIGNEE+25* |
>> DATAKEY | DESIGNEE+11* |
DD | DESIGNEE+23! |
DIC | DESIGNEE+1~, DESIGNEE+21*, CONFIRM+4~, CONFIRM+6* |
DIC("P" | DESIGNEE+22* |
DIC(0 | DESIGNEE+21* |
DIE | SEC3+1~, SEC3+25*, SEC3+29!, NMSSNDOB+2~, NMSSNDOB+18*, DESIGNEE+1~, DESIGNEE+25* |
>> DINUM | DESIGNEE+21* |
DIQ | CONFIRM+4~, CONFIRM+6* |
DIQ(0 | CONFIRM+6* |
>> DLAYGO | DESIGNEE+21* |
DO | DESIGNEE+23! |
DR | SEC3+1~, SEC3+26*, SEC3+27*, SEC3+29!, NMSSNDOB+2~, NMSSNDOB+18!, NMSSNDOB+20*, DESIGNEE+1~, DESIGNEE+26*, CONFIRM+4~ , CONFIRM+6* |
DR(1 | DESIGNEE+25* |
EAPREQ | SEC3+1~, SEC3+3*, SEC3+21* |
EASAPP | SEC3+24, SEC3+30, NMSSNDOB+3, NMSSNDOB+4, NMSSNDOB+5, NMSSNDOB+6, NMSSNDOB+13, NMSSNDOB+15, NMSSNDOB+16, NMSSNDOB+18 , VETTYPE~, VETTYPE+6, VETTYPE+7, VETTYPE+8, VETTYPE+9, VETTYPE+10, DESIGNEE+3, DESIGNEE+15, DESIGNEE+20, DESIGNEE+22 , DESIGNEE+25, CONFIRM~, CONFIRM+5, CONFIRM+6, CONFIRM+8, CONFIRM+12 |
EASDATA | DESIGNEE+1~, DESIGNEE+15*, DESIGNEE+16 |
>> EASDOB | NMSSNDOB+15*, NMSSNDOB+19 |
EASIEN | DESIGNEE+1~, DESIGNEE+20*, DESIGNEE+21, DESIGNEE+25 |
>> EASNAME | NMSSNDOB+3*, NMSSNDOB+4*, NMSSNDOB+7, NMSSNDOB+8*, NMSSNDOB+9*, NMSSNDOB+10* |
>> EASSSN | NMSSNDOB+13*, NMSSNDOB+19 |
EASWEBID | SEC3+3*, SEC3+15*, CONFIRM~, CONFIRM+5, CONFIRM+9, CONFIRM+13 |
EASXMZ | CONFIRM~ |
ECOMM | SEC3+1~, SEC3+30 |
ECOMM( | SEC3+8*, SEC3+9* |
EDETL | SEC3+1~, SEC3+3*, SEC3+19* |
SEC3+1~, SEC3+3*, SEC3+16* | |
ERR | SEC3+1~ |
ESERV | SEC3+1~, SEC3+3*, SEC3+22* |
EVERS | SEC3+1~, SEC3+3*, SEC3+17* |
EXPECT | SEC3+1~, SEC3+3*, SEC3+18* |
>> EZDATA | DESIGNEE+3*, DESIGNEE+4 |
>> I | DESIGNEE+7* |
>> JJ | SEC3+7*, SEC3+8, SEC3+9, SEC3+10* |
KEY | NMSSNDOB+2~, NMSSNDOB+3*, NMSSNDOB+4*, NMSSNDOB+5*, NMSSNDOB+6*, NMSSNDOB+12*, NMSSNDOB+13, NMSSNDOB+14*, NMSSNDOB+15, VETTYPE+4~ , VETTYPE+6*, VETTYPE+7*, VETTYPE+8*, VETTYPE+9*, VETTYPE+10*, DESIGNEE+1~, DESIGNEE+2*, DESIGNEE+3, DESIGNEE+9*, DESIGNEE+10 , DESIGNEE+11, DESIGNEE+15 |
KEY(1 | NMSSNDOB+17* |
>> KEYIEN | DESIGNEE+11*, DESIGNEE+19*, DESIGNEE+21 |
LINE | SEC3+1~, SEC3+5*, SEC3+6, SEC3+7, SEC3+8, SEC3+9, SEC3+13*, SEC3+14, SEC3+15, SEC3+16 , SEC3+17, SEC3+18, SEC3+19, SEC3+21, SEC3+22 |
MDL | NMSSNDOB+2~, NMSSNDOB+5*, NMSSNDOB+7*, NMSSNDOB+8 |
MRET | VETTYPE+4~, VETTYPE+10*, VETTYPE+15 |
MULTIPLE | DESIGNEE+1~, DESIGNEE+13*, DESIGNEE+15 |
N | NMSSNDOB+2~ |
N(1 | NMSSNDOB+17* |
>> NOCOMM | SEC3+7*, SEC3+12*, SEC3+14* |
OUT | SEC3+1~, SEC3+3*, SEC3+4, SEC3+6*, SEC3+7, SEC3+12* |
PH | VETTYPE+4~, VETTYPE+6*, VETTYPE+12 |
POW | VETTYPE+4~, VETTYPE+7*, VETTYPE+13 |
SC | VETTYPE+4~, VETTYPE+8*, VETTYPE+14 |
SCPC | VETTYPE+4~, VETTYPE+9*, VETTYPE+14 |
STN | CONFIRM+4~, CONFIRM+8*, CONFIRM+10 |
SUFF | NMSSNDOB+2~, NMSSNDOB+6*, NMSSNDOB+9 |
TYPE | VETTYPE+14*, DESIGNEE+1~, DESIGNEE+4*, DESIGNEE+5*, DESIGNEE+9 |
U | SEC3+8, SEC3+15, SEC3+16, SEC3+17, SEC3+18, SEC3+19, SEC3+21, SEC3+22, NMSSNDOB+3, NMSSNDOB+4 , NMSSNDOB+5, NMSSNDOB+6, NMSSNDOB+13, NMSSNDOB+15, NMSSNDOB+17, VETTYPE+6, VETTYPE+7, VETTYPE+8, VETTYPE+9, VETTYPE+10 , DESIGNEE+3, DESIGNEE+11, DESIGNEE+15, DESIGNEE+22, CONFIRM+8 |
VETTYPE | NMSSNDOB+16*, VETTYPE+4~ |
X | SEC3+1~, SEC3+18*, SEC3+21*, SEC3+29!, NMSSNDOB+2~, DESIGNEE+1~, DESIGNEE+7*, DESIGNEE+8, DESIGNEE+15*, DESIGNEE+19* , DESIGNEE+21* |
XMDUZ | CONFIRM+4~, CONFIRM+13* |
>> XMER | SEC3+4, SEC3+12 |
>> XMREC | SEC3+4, SEC3+11 |
>> XMRG | SEC3+5, SEC3+13 |
XMSUB | CONFIRM+4~, CONFIRM+13* |
XMTEXT | CONFIRM+4~, CONFIRM+15* |
XMY | CONFIRM+4~ |
XMY("1010EZ.1010EZ@DOMAIN.EXT" | CONFIRM+14* |
XMZ | CONFIRM+4~ |
XPART | DESIGNEE+1~, DESIGNEE+8*, DESIGNEE+9, DESIGNEE+19 |
Y | SEC3+29!, NMSSNDOB+2~, DESIGNEE+1~ |
ZX | NMSSNDOB+2~, NMSSNDOB+19* |
Name | Field # of Occurrence |
---|---|
$T(DSGDAT+I | DESIGNEE+7 |